After last minute cancellations Thursday and Friday of last week, dancers finally got the chance to audition to appear in Britney Spears' next music video and possible tour. But the pop star skipped the tryouts, opting instead to drive her black Audi between her Malibu and Beverly Hills homes with paparazzi in tow.
As Spears performed her usual cross-town car trek, close to a hundred hopefuls lined up outside North Hollywood's Millenium Dance Studio on Monday night for a five o'clock audition call. A half an hour later, they were divided into lines and one by one were given two opportunities to impress Studio owner Robert Baker with their moves to the chorus of Spears' new hit single, "Gimme More."
Usmagazine.com has learned that dancers who make it to the next level will be notified within 24 hours.
"I would have liked to have seen her, because I've never seen a real live recording artist before," dancer Chris Pow, 18, told Us. "But I'm just glad to have an audition."
Millenium owner Baker spoke to Us after Spears' first cancellation on October 11. "Something came up at the last minute," he explained at the time (the "something" was an emergency hearing in her ongoing custody case with Kevin Federline).
Though no tour has been announced, Baker tells Us that Spears' booking patterns at Millenium mirror past pre-tour schedules. "The tell-tale sign for us is her booking space -- it's her typical warm-up behavior for a tour," he said. "She's done it this way before all her tours. It's a big sign that she's getting back her focus after all these distractions."
